Biathlon at the 2022 Winter Paralympics – Women's 10 kilometres

The Women's 10 kilometres competition of the 2022 Winter Paralympics took place on 8 March 2022.

Visually impaired

In the biathlon visually impaired, the athlete with a visual impairment has a sighted guide.[1] The two skiers are considered a team, and dual medals are awarded.

Anastasiia Laletina did not compete in the middle-distance race after her father was captured by Russian forces during the Russian invasion of Ukraine.[5]
